solve-x/export-tools
Composer 安装命令:
composer require solve-x/export-tools
包简介
Export tools
关键字:
README 文档
README
Fast MySQL-to-Excel exporter
This library uses MySQL's SELECT INTO OUTFILE feature to export selected rows into a csv file
and then converts that csv into xlsx via a C-language program (Linux only). This is much faster than other pure PHP
solutions.
Example usage:
<?php use SolveX\ExportTools\ExcelExporter; $db = app('db'); // Illuminate\Database\ConnectionInterface (Laravel) $excelExporter = new ExcelExporter($db); $sql = "SELECT first_name, last_name, phone, email FROM `customers` WHERE id = 1"; $columns = ['First Name', 'Last Name', 'Phone', 'Email']; $path = $excelExporter->export($sql, $columns);
统计信息
- 总下载量: 32
- 月度下载量: 0
- 日度下载量: 0
- 收藏数: 3
- 点击次数: 0
- 依赖项目数: 0
- 推荐数: 0
其他信息
- 授权协议: Unknown
- 更新时间: 2017-09-08